Flexible Linear Shaped Charge Modeling
Hi !!! all
I am doing the Hydrocode simulation using AUTODYN 2D Explicit Hydrodynamic Code. There is apoint of doubt in simulation of a 2D problem regarding the location of Detonation inside the explosive. In the case of a conical shaped charge it is very easy to assume the detonation at the apex of the cone but in case of FLSC being a linear cord and the initiation is done axially, it is very difficult to assume the same condition as that of conical shaped charge.
